Abstract (EN): This paper discusses the effective contribution of a Learning Object (LO) to teach circuit theory based on research conducted with students of higher education, and their interaction with a teacher of Electronics. From the results of such research, it is pointed out which features one wants in the LO so that it successfully promotes learning. It is in this perspective that this work was conceived having as goal the development of LO, admitting that this may be a possible alternative to represent models of interactions, which occur within the area, thereby improving understanding of physical concepts, in particular those involved with the subject of electrical circuits. It has also as objective to characterize the learning process through a series of situations that are replicated leading to a set of behaviors from the students. It is assumed that the use of this tool can lead to acquiring a specific set of skills, a better practice and meaningful learning.
